Situated close to Chesterton High Street and Nuffield Road, Cam Causeway is approximately two and a half miles from the City Centre, well placed for access to Cambridge Science Parks, ten minutes from Cambridge North Railway Station and is close the A14, which links with the major road networks. There is also the recent addition of a cycle lane throughout Chesterton and there is a regular bus service to Addenbrooke's and the City itself. There is pedestrian access via the towpath to the River Cam, Stourbridge Common and the City Centre. Chesterton benefits from a wealth of local amenities and the property falls into the catchment of the Ofsted rated "Good" Shirley Community Primary School (which is 0.1 miles from the property, less than five minutes walk) & the "Good" North Cambridge Academy (which is 1.3 miles from the property). Chesterton offers an excellent range of local facilities, including a good variety of shops.
